The Yung percutaneous mastoid vent: a medium-term follow-up study.

BACKGROUND I designed a percutaneous mastoid vent to provide permanent ventilation to the middle ear. The vent consists of an outer titanium tube that osseointegrates with the mastoid bone and an inner Teflon tube that protrudes into the mastoid antrum.
